Secretary’s Report
December 18, 2024
Vice President Kirk Kubic brought the meeting to order in the absence of President Rick Stephens.
Treasurer Larry Meyer made a motion to hold acoustic jam sessions on the 4th Sunday of Every month to accommodate those who do not wish to participate in the regular jam sessions on the 2nd Sunday of the month with amplified instruments.
The motion was voted on and passed by all officers present.
The first acoustic jam will begin on February 25th, 2024.
Addie Idler, board member, is going to contact Humanities Nebraska for a Grant. Our roof needs replacing in the near future and a grant is the only option to procure enough funds for this replacement
Larry is going to check dates of other activities surrounding a possible date for our next festival in 2024.
Kirk Kubic made a motion to control the sound in the theater with a decibel meter during jam sessions and performances.
The motion was voted on and passed by all officers present.
Kirk will purchase a meter for this purpose.
Kirk made a motion to adjourn the meeting and Larry seconded the motion.
End of Secretary’s report. By Addie Idler

Artist of the month
Paul Overstreet
Paul Overstreet has won 2 Grammy awards in the country music genre as a singer and a song writer. He has also written songs for 6 other artists in the country music field.
In addition he has written many top ten hits for himself.
His first album produced 3 number one hits. From SKO (Skyler Knobloc and Overstreet.)
His first project on his own on the album “Sowin Love” produced 5 singles that were top ten hits
Some of his subsequent albums have done like wise.
